When Flappy Bird first took the mobile gaming world by storm in 2013, few could have predicted its enduring legacy on desktop platforms. The transition from touchscreen to keyboard/mouse controls has created a completely different gaming dynamic that appeals to competitive players worldwide. Our exclusive data shows that PC players achieve scores 47% higher on average than their mobile counterparts, thanks to precise input controls and reduced latency.

The Indian gaming community has particularly embraced Flappy Bird For PC, with downloads increasing by 300% in the last two years alone. This surge coincides with the growing accessibility of affordable gaming PCs across the subcontinent. Unlike the mobile version that faced removal from app stores, the PC iteration has flourished through web-based platforms and downloadable clients.

The Technical Superiority of Desktop Gaming

Playing Flappy Bird on a computer isn't just about screen size—it's about precision engineering. The game's physics engine runs more consistently on desktop processors, eliminating the frame rate drops that plague mobile devices during intense gameplay sessions. This technical advantage is why competitive players increasingly favor the PC version for tournament play.

The Cultural Impact of Flappy Bird in India 🇮🇳

In India, Flappy Bird has transcended its status as a mere game to become a cultural touchstone. The PC version's popularity coincides with the country's digital transformation, where affordable computing has reached previously underserved communities.

Internet cafes across Mumbai, Delhi, and Bangalore report that Flappy Bird remains one of the most requested games, particularly in its PC iteration. The game's simple requirements mean it can run on even the most basic systems common in public access centers.

Local Tournaments and Community Events

College festivals and local gaming competitions frequently feature Flappy Bird For PC tournaments, with prize pools sometimes exceeding ₹50,000. These events demonstrate the game's lasting appeal and competitive depth—qualities often overlooked by casual observers who dismiss it as a simple mobile time-waster.

The community aspect has flourished particularly around the PC version, where players can more easily stream their gameplay, share strategies, and organize competitions. This social dimension adds longevity that the original mobile version lacked.
